A skill for searching the web with Baidu AI Search, a Chinese search service. It supports query terms, result counts, and optional date ranges.

In plain words
What is it for?
Use it for real-time information searches and document retrieval, including searches limited to recent days, months, or a specified date range.
Why use it?
It provides a documented way to retrieve current web results when Baidu search coverage or Chinese-language sources are useful.

百度搜索

通过百度 AI 搜索 API 进行网页搜索。

前置条件

API 密钥配置

本技能需要配置 BAIDU_API_KEY 环境变量。

如果您还没有 API 密钥,请访问: https://console.bce.baidu.com/ai-search/qianfan/ais/console/apiKey

详细的配置步骤请参阅: references/apikey-fetch.md

使用方法

python3 skills/baidu-search-zh/scripts/search.py '<JSON>'

请求参数

参数 类型 必填 默认值 说明
query str - 搜索关键词
count int 10 返回结果数量,范围 1-50
freshness str 时间范围,两种格式:格式一为 "YYYY-MM-DDtoYYYY-MM-DD";格式二包括 pd、pw、pm、py,分别代表过去 24 小时、过去 7 天、过去 31 天和过去 365 天

示例

# 基础搜索
python3 scripts/search.py '{"query":"人工智能"}'

# 时间范围格式一 "YYYY-MM-DDtoYYYY-MM-DD" 示例
python3 scripts/search.py '{
  "query":"最新新闻",
  "freshness":"2025-09-01to2025-09-08"
}'

# 时间范围格式二 pd、pw、pm、py 示例
python3 scripts/search.py '{
  "query":"最新新闻",
  "freshness":"pd"
}'

# 设置 count 参数,指定返回结果数量
python3 scripts/search.py '{
  "query":"旅游景点",
  "count": 20
}'
